Transaction 6a224dd4c609b23062045e6802db1c7d235374b31664e864be151cf37d73a8b4

2 Input
2 Outputs
  • 6a224dd4c609b23062045e6802db1c7d235374b31664e864be151cf37d73a8b4:0
  • value  632000
    address  35fbNGdBSkX2THzbSCVPMJgUHaKVDLAffs
  • 6a224dd4c609b23062045e6802db1c7d235374b31664e864be151cf37d73a8b4:1
  • value  1602709
    address  17dc6rs4otXAJXySCuXBA6BKhvhEKSAbB2